
Kellogg's, Battle Creek, Michigan
Boiler Blowdown Cooling System
Boiler blowdown water needs to be cooled at 140F before draining to sewer system. Original blowdown heat exchanger system had chronic plugging and high maintenance. Kellogg's changed to direct-injection cooling water which still caused plugging and wasted water. ThermalTech was brought in to design and implement a non-contact heat exchanger designed for ease of maintenance and reliability.
Benefit:
The temperature of the blowdown water remains consistently within requirements and no plug-ups have occurred (more than two years run time compared to problems every few months previously!). Use of city water has been eliminated.
